Your truck has a body lift which means that it also has aftermarket brackets to reposition the bumper after the lift. That's what is making your bumper adjustment different. You actually have 8 bolts involved, not 4.

If you only loosen the bolts in the photo on each side, it won't move. There is another set on the inboard side of each of the frame rails. You can just barely see the washer for one of them in the 3rd photo.
